#355bfe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#355bfe is composed of 20.8% red, 35.7%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.1% cyan, 64.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 228.7 degrees, a saturation of 99% and a lightness of 60.2%. #355bfe color hex could be obtained by blending #6ab6ff with #0000fd.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#355bfe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#355bfe has RGB values of R:53, G:91,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0.64,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 3496958.

Hex triplet 355bfe #355bfe
RGB Decimal 53, 91, 254 rgb(53,91,254)
RGB Percent 20.8, 35.7, 99.6 rgb(20.8%,35.7%,99.6%)
CMYK 79, 64, 0, 0
HSL 228.7°, 99, 60.2 hsl(228.7,99%,60.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 228.7°, 79.1, 99.6
Web Safe 3366ff #3366ff
CIE-LAB 46.168, 44.04, -84.269
XYZ 23.095, 15.393, 95.514
xyY 0.172, 0.115, 15.393
CIE-LCH 46.168, 95.083, 297.592
CIE-LUV 46.168, -16.166, -127.262
Hunter-Lab 39.234, 36.414, -116.876
Binary 00110101, 01011011, 11111110

Shades and Tints of #355bfe

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00020d is the darkest color, while #f8f9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#355bfe

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9395a0 is the less saturated color, while #355bfe is the most saturated one.
